Conversational BI on Mobile: Designing for On-the-Go Insights

The best mobile analytics interface is not a dashboard squeezed onto a phone — it is a conversation: ask a question, get the answer, drill down, done. With mobile devices now accounting for roughly 60% of global web traffic and executives living in chat apps, conversational BI delivered inside WeChat Work, DingTalk, Feishu, Teams, or Slack is how data finally reaches decisions made away from a desk. This article covers the mobile-first design patterns that make conversational analytics work on small screens, in meetings, and between messages.

What Does the Current Conversational BI Landscape Look Like?

The case for mobile-first conversational analytics rests on two shifts that are already settled. First, where the audience is: Statista data shows mobile devices have accounted for around 60% of global website traffic in recent years, and the enterprise equivalent is the same story — knowledge workers spend their day in chat and IM applications, and their decisions happen in them. Second, what the tools can do now: Gartner projected in October 2023 that more than 80% of enterprises will have used generative AI APIs or models in production by 2026, up from less than 5% in early 2023, and McKinsey's State of AI research in early 2024 found that 65% of organizations regularly use generative AI. The capability that was a demo five years ago — ask a question in plain language, receive a grounded, explained answer — is now production-grade, and the natural delivery surface is the phone in the user's hand and the chat app they never close.

The design implication is that the desktop dashboard is no longer the primary interface to data. Gartner predicted in 2019 that by 2025 data stories would become the most widespread way of consuming data, overtaking dashboards, and the mobile conversation is the purest form of that shift: the question, the answer, the why, all in a thread that fits on a screen and travels into a meeting.

What Principles and Strategic Framework Should You Follow?

Mobile conversational BI succeeds when four principles are designed in from the start. The first is answer-first formatting: on a phone, the answer must arrive before the explanation — the number or trend up front, the reasoning, caveats, and drill-downs below, so that a user who only reads the first line still got the answer. The second is conversational continuity: the system must hold context across turns ("and what about last quarter?") and across sessions, because mobile usage is fragmented into dozens of short interactions rather than one long analysis session. The third is IM-native delivery: the experience lives where the conversation lives — a chat thread in the company's IM tool — rather than forcing users into a separate app they will not open. The fourth is frictionless input: typed questions, voice input, quick-reply chips for follow-ups, and shared charts that render natively in the chat, because every extra tap is a lost question on mobile.

The strategic test for any mobile conversational BI rollout is whether it changes who asks questions. If the interface works, the CFO's question in a taxi gets answered the same as the analyst's question at a desk — and the democratization of data access is the actual ROI.

What Should a Mobile Conversational BI Experience Actually Do?

The design patterns that separate a working mobile analytics experience from a desktop port are concrete:

  • Answer-first cards. The response is a structured card — headline number, mini-chart, one-line explanation — sized for a phone screen, with details hidden behind a tap rather than spread across the view.
  • Voice input with confirmable intent. Users dictate questions while walking or between meetings, and the system echoes its interpretation ("Revenue by region, Q3, compared to Q2?") so the user can correct before the query runs.
  • Quick-reply drill-downs. After an answer, the system offers the likely follow-ups — "by product," "by region," "last 12 months" — as one-tap chips, which is how mobile users deepen an analysis without typing.
  • Proactive alerts in-thread. Threshold breaches and scheduled digests arrive as messages in the same chat, turning the assistant from pull-only into a system that tells you when the number that matters moves.
  • Offline and low-bandwidth resilience. Answers are cached, and slow networks degrade gracefully — the last asked questions and the latest digest remain available with a clear freshness indicator.
  • Native chart rendering. Charts render inside the IM message rather than as links to a portal, so the answer is shareable into any meeting thread without leaving the conversation.

Notice what is deliberately absent: dashboards, drill-down hierarchies, and any interface that assumes a mouse. The mobile experience is a question-and-answer loop, and everything in it is designed to make the next question easier to ask.

How Should You Implement a Mobile Conversational BI Rollout?

Mobile conversational BI should be deployed the way any conversational analytics program should be deployed — narrow, fast, and over data you already have. Pick one audience and one decision: sales leadership wanting pipeline answers on the go, or operations managers checking daily KPIs from the floor. Connect to the warehouse or data platform you already run, define the metrics once in a governed semantic layer, and deliver the first working assistant in the IM tool that audience already lives in. Two practices protect the rollout. First, test on real phones with real users from day one: the failure modes of mobile analytics — mis-rendered charts, lost context, slow answers on a weak signal — only appear in the field. Second, keep a human in the loop for accuracy: mobile users tolerate less friction, so a wrong answer destroys trust faster on a phone than on a desktop, and the accuracy bar must be set accordingly.

What Are the Hardest Parts of Going Mobile-First?

The hard parts are rarely the ones vendors advertise. Security is first: mobile devices are untrusted endpoints, so row-level security, session management, and data minimization must be enforced as strictly on a phone as in the data center — and the chat platform adds a channel that security teams will scrutinize. Context is second: mobile sessions are short and interrupted, so the system must reconstruct the analytical context — which metrics, which filters, which comparison period — from the thread, without making the user re-explain everything. Third is answer quality under constraint: a good mobile answer is short, and writing a short, correct, caveated answer is harder than writing a long one, which is why the narration layer needs the same tuning attention as the query layer. Fourth is freshness signaling: mobile users act on answers, so the system must show how current the data is — a stale number delivered confidently to a phone is worse than no answer. Each of these is solvable, but none of them is solved by buying a bigger language model; they are solved by architecture and operations.

How Do You Measure Success and Demonstrate ROI?

The metrics for mobile conversational BI are the metrics of usage and decision velocity. Operationally: questions asked per user per week, share of sessions under thirty seconds that still produce a kept answer, follow-up rate (users drilling down, which indicates the answer was useful), and answer accuracy against a gold set. Business-wise: time from question to decision, the share of recurring decisions made with data in the room, and the number of questions coming from roles that never touched the dashboard — the democratization signal. The strategic metric is stickiness: an assistant that is embedded in daily workflow gets used in the taxi, in the meeting, and at the floor — and usage growth over quarters is the honest proof that the experience works. Baselines matter: measure today's question-to-answer time and who asks questions before rollout, then re-measure at ninety days. What Are the Common Pitfalls and How Do You Avoid Them?

The most common failure is porting the desktop dashboard to mobile and calling it strategy — the result is an interface nobody uses and a program that dies quietly. The second is building a standalone app instead of living in the IM tool: users will not open a separate analytics app on a phone, no matter how good it is. The third is ignoring security and governance until IT objects, which then stalls the rollout at the worst moment. The fourth is treating the language model as the product: without a governed semantic layer and a tuned narration layer, mobile answers are fluent but wrong, and trust evaporates fast on a phone. The fifth is skipping the human feedback loop — every corrected answer is training signal, and a mobile system that does not learn from corrections stays permanently mediocre. Start by picking the single decision that most frustrates a mobile workforce today — a field manager who needs yesterday's sales before a store opens, a technician who needs the failure rate of a part on site, a regional lead who needs to explain a margin move on the train. The first use case should be narrow enough to ship in two weeks and valuable enough that people return to it. Resist the urge to connect every report at once; the goal is a working daily habit, not a library.

Design for the thumb, not the dashboard. On a phone, the answer card is the unit of value: one clear number or sentence, a source, and a single obvious next step such as a follow-up question or a drill-down. Voice input with a confirmable intent helps in environments where typing is unsafe or slow, and quick-reply chips turn a monologue into a loop. The teams that win on mobile treat the conversation as the interface and the BI platform as the engine behind it, not the other way around.

Make trust visible. Every answer should name its source and its freshness, and every number should be traceable to the system of record. On a small screen, users will not dig — so the citation has to be one tap away, and the confidence signal has to be honest. Instrument adoption from day one. Track weekly active questioners, questions per user, and the share of answers that lead to a follow-up or a decision, and watch whether the audience grows beyond the original team. These are the signals that the mobile habit is forming; a flat line means the first use case was not painful enough, and that is a cheaper lesson at week two than at month six. Fold the feedback into the next audience and the next data source, expanding connector by connector.

Finally, plan the governance before the rollout, not after. Define who owns each data source, how access is scoped to the mobile audience, and what happens when an answer looks wrong — a fallback to a human or a pinned report. Mobile conversational BI is not a lighter version of desktop analytics; it is analytics that travels with the decision, and the discipline that keeps it trustworthy is the same discipline that keeps any data product honest.
